Study On Pedicle Screw Fixation Of Cervical Spine Assisted By Iso-C3D Navigation System Or The Individual MPR Placement Technique

Objective To discuss the accuracy and feasibility of cervical pedicle screwfixation assisted by Iso-C3D navigation system or the Individual MPR PlacementTechnique.Methods There were eight adult cadaver specimens of cervica spine (C1-T1)excluding specimens of osteoporosis by X-ray.The spiral computed tomography scanand MPR reconstruction of4cervical specimens were taken,To determine theentrance spot and direction of placement nails according to CT measurements,Thenappropriate screws were inserted into the C2-C7pedicles individually with the helpwith lateral C-arm fluoroscopy.In the other4human cadaver cervical vertebraes,3.5mm screws were inserted into the pedicles assisted by Iso-C3D navigationsystem.Cortical integrity of every sample was examined by the spiral CT scan.Resultsthirty-eight screws were inserted into pedicle by Iso-C3D navigation system,91.7%of the screws were placed entirely within the pedicle,6.2%showednon-critical breaches, and2.1%showed critical breaches;48screws were placed into pedicle assisted by the Individual MPR PlacementTechnique,70.8%of were placed entirely within the pedicle,12.5%showednon-critical breaches, and16.7%showed critical breaches.Pedicle screw perforation segmental distribution:a total of18screw,C2(0),C3(8),C4(5),C5(3),C6(1),C7(1),where C3、C4accounted for72.2%.Distribution of pedicle screw perforation directions: a total of18screw,the medial(2),lateral(11),upper(4),lower(1),where the lateral accounted for61.1%.there was statistical significance between the accuracy rate of two methods(P<0.05).Conclusion Compared with the Individual MPR Placement Technique,theaccuracy ratio of pedicle screw fixation of cervical spine assisted by Iso-C3Dnavigation system is higher;The imbedding of pedicle screw C3、C4in eachvertebrae of lower cervical spine was with comparatively higher risk,whenimbedding,the angle of screw was partial to the inner side,which was more reliableand safer.
